STIHL 2-MIX-Engine
2-stroke engine with stratified charge. A fuel-free layer of air is created between the burned charge in the combustion chamber and the fresh charge in the crankcase, reducing the amount of fuel lost during the charge cycle. This results in more power with a lower weight, up to 20% lower fuel consumption than regular 2-stroke engines and significantly reduced exhaust emissions.

Simplified starting system
Simply set the choke, pump the fuel primer, pull the starter cord and away you go! The running machine then switches off after a brief press of the stop button. Once the machine is at a standstill, the ignition activates again automatically. Thus the ignition is always ready for starting.


Manual fuel pump (Purger)
A small fuel pump delivers fuel to the carburettor at the touch of a button. This reduces the number of starting strokes required following extended breaks in operations.
| Technical specifications | Values |
|---|---|
| Displacement | 27,2 cm³ |
| Power output | 0,8/1,1 kW/bhp |
| Weight 1) | 4,7 kg |
| Sound pressure level with plastic tool 2) | 93 dB(A) |
| Sound power level 2) | 108 dB(A) |
| Vibration level, left/right with plastic tool 3) | 6,5/7,5 m/s² |
| Total length 4) | 170 cm |
| Cutting tool | Grass cutting blade 230-2 |
